Lamentations 3:17 I've forgotten what the good life is like. I said to myself, "This is it. I'm finished. God is a lost cause." I'll never forget the trouble, the utter lostness, the ‘taste of ashes, the poison I've swallowed. I remember it all—oh, how well I remember—the feeling of hitting the bottom.  COMMENT I’m re-living the past – I’ve forgotten the good life - forgotten God - but I’ve not forgotten the trouble! So I have no hope. But there's one other thing I remember, and remembering, I keep a grip on hope: God's loyal love couldn't have run out, his merciful love couldn't have dried up. They're created new every morning. How great is your faithfulness! I'm sticking with God (I say it over and over). He's all I've got left. COMMENT I’m still thinking of the past but I’m remembering God’s loyal love – His merciful love – His faithfulness – I’m declaring my faithfulness – He is my only hope!
